Adding Aromatics and Flavorings

As we sauté the chicken hearts, it’s time to add the aromatics that will elevate the dish to new heights. To bring out the rich flavor of the chicken hearts, we’ll add some onions, garlic, and thyme.

To add these aromatics, follow these steps:

  1. Mince 2 cloves of garlic and 1 small onion.
  2. Add 1 tablespoon of olive oil to the pan and sauté the garlic and onion until they’re translucent.
  3. Add 1 teaspoon of dried thyme and cook for an additional minute.
IngredientMeasurement
Garlic2 cloves
Onion1 small
Olive Oil1 tablespoon
Thyme1 teaspoon

Simmering the Dish

Close-up of chicken hearts simmering in a flavorful broth in a cast-iron skillet, garnished with fresh herbs, with steam rising and a rustic kitchen background.
Tender chicken hearts simmered to perfection in a rich, aromatic broth, garnished with fresh herbs. A comforting and flavorful dish that brings warmth to any table.

As the aroma of sautéed ingredients fills the air, it’s time to take your chicken hearts to the next level by simmering the dish. This crucial step allows the flavors to meld together, creating a rich and savory sauce. To achieve this, follow these simple steps:

  1. Reduce the heat to a gentle simmer.
  2. Add 1/2 cup of chicken broth and 1 tablespoon of tomato paste to the pan.
  3. Let the mixture simmer for 10-15 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the sauce has thickened and the hearts are fully coated.

Some quick tips to keep in mind:

  • Use a low heat to prevent the sauce from burning or sticking to the pan.
  • Stir the mixture regularly to ensure even cooking and to prevent the chicken hearts from becoming tough.
